T
Theresa Lim Review of Blu Kouzina
Food is excellent but I am taking one star off bec...
Food is excellent but I am taking one star off because everything is so salty! Every dish can do with less salt.
Food is excellent but I am taking one star off because everything is so salty! Every dish can do with less salt.
Comments: